| from typing import Any | |
| import torch | |
| from . import logging | |
| from .import_utils import is_torch_npu_available | |
| logger = logging.get_logger(__name__) | |
| IS_CUDA_AVAILABLE = torch.cuda.is_available() | |
| IS_NPU_AVAILABLE = is_torch_npu_available() | |
| if IS_NPU_AVAILABLE: | |
| torch.npu.config.allow_internal_format = False | |
| def get_device_type() -> str: | |
| """Get device type based on current machine, currently only support CPU, CUDA, NPU.""" | |
| if IS_CUDA_AVAILABLE: | |
| device = "cuda" | |
| elif IS_NPU_AVAILABLE: | |
| device = "npu" | |
| else: | |
| device = "cpu" | |
| return device | |
| def get_device_name() -> str: | |
| """Get real device name, e.g. A100, H100""" | |
| return get_torch_device().get_device_name() | |
| def get_torch_device() -> Any: | |
| """Get torch attribute based on device type, e.g. torch.cuda or torch.npu""" | |
| device_name = get_device_type() | |
| try: | |
| return getattr(torch, device_name) | |
| except AttributeError: | |
| logger.warning(f"Device namespace '{device_name}' not found in torch, try to load 'torch.cuda'.") | |
| return torch.cuda | |
| def get_device_id() -> int: | |
| """Get current device id based on device type.""" | |
| return get_torch_device().current_device() | |
| def get_dist_comm_backend() -> str: | |
| """Return distributed communication backend type based on device type.""" | |
| if IS_CUDA_AVAILABLE: | |
| return "nccl" | |
| elif IS_NPU_AVAILABLE: | |
| return "hccl" | |
| else: | |
| raise RuntimeError(f"No available distributed communication backend found on device type {get_device_type()}.") | |
| def synchronize() -> None: | |
| """Execute torch synchronize operation.""" | |
| get_torch_device().synchronize() | |
| def stream_synchronize() -> None: | |
| """Execute device stream synchronize operation.""" | |
| if IS_CUDA_AVAILABLE: | |
| torch.cuda.current_stream().synchronize() | |
| elif IS_NPU_AVAILABLE: | |
| torch.npu.current_stream().synchronize() | |
| else: | |
| synchronize() | |
| def empty_cache() -> None: | |
| """Execute torch empty cache operation.""" | |
| get_torch_device().empty_cache() | |
| def set_device(device: torch.types.Device) -> None: | |
| """Execute set device operation.""" | |
| get_torch_device().set_device(device) | |
| def is_nccl_backend() -> bool: | |
| """Check if the distributed communication backend is NCCL.""" | |
| return get_dist_comm_backend() == "nccl" | |
| def is_hccl_backend() -> bool: | |
| """Check if the distributed communication backend is HCCL.""" | |
| return get_dist_comm_backend() == "hccl" | |
| def get_gpu_compute_capability() -> int: | |
| """Return the compute capability as an integer (e.g. 70, 80, 90), or 0 if no GPU.""" | |
| if not IS_CUDA_AVAILABLE: | |
| return 0 | |
| major, minor = torch.cuda.get_device_capability() | |
| return major * 10 + minor | |
| def is_sm90_or_above() -> bool: | |
| """Check if the current CUDA device has SM90+ capability.""" | |
| return get_gpu_compute_capability() >= 90 | |
| def get_compute_units(): | |
| """ | |
| Returns the number of streaming multiprocessors (SMs) or equivalent compute units | |
| for the available accelerator. Assigns the value to NUM_SMS. | |
| """ | |
| NUM_SMS = None | |
| device_type = getattr(torch.accelerator.current_accelerator(), "type", "cpu") | |
| # Use match/case for device-specific logic (Python 3.10+) | |
| match device_type: | |
| case "cuda": | |
| device_properties = torch.cuda.get_device_properties(0) | |
| NUM_SMS = device_properties.multi_processor_count | |
| case "xpu": | |
| device_properties = torch.xpu.get_device_properties(0) | |
| NUM_SMS = device_properties.max_compute_units | |
| case _: | |
| print("No CUDA or XPU device available. Using CPU.") | |
| # For CPU, you might want to use the number of CPU cores | |
| NUM_SMS = torch.get_num_threads() | |
| return NUM_SMS | |
